The Colin Campbell Cafe in Royston, Hertfordshire.
Locals have donated books, that people of the armed forces can borrow, free of charge.. Officer in the picture is un named.
Picture taken 9th October 1944

The Colin Campbell Cafe in Royston, Hertfordshire, captured in this poignant print from 1944, serves as a testament to the generosity and support of the local community during World War II. As conflict raged on, locals rallied together to donate books that could be borrowed by members of the armed forces free of charge. This small act of kindness provided solace and escapism for those serving their country far from home.
